  • Hall of Fame Plugin
  • Version: 1.0
  • Author: Carola Fanselow

About

This plugin lists the achievments of users (=assignments to submissions). Users are catagorizes according to the number of achievments for a certain role: gold, silver, bronze users, most volatile and most active user. The submissions they worked on are also listed. A medal count ranks the users according to their achievmentsSpecifications in the settings:

  • user groups to be included in the hall of fame
  • path to the hall of fame
  • date where to start counting
  • percentile ranks for gold and silver medal
  • whether to restrict the number of people listed in the medal count
  • definition of "recency" (for the most active users)
  • minimal number of series to be awarded the series star
  • whether to add links to public profiles
  • whether to use Unified Style Sheet for Linguistics

System Requirements

This plugin is compatible with...

  • OMP 1.2.0

Installation

To install the plugin:

  • Upload the tar.gz file in OMP (Management > Website Settings > Plugins > Generic Plugins)
